Default Amp Questions

I tried the search and it came back with no matches and I don't recall seeing any opinions on Extant equipment. I'm looking at the X 603e to run either Focal 165KP or Diamond S600 and a 10" sub. Seems a little under powered for the Diamonds but any input on power and quality are welcome.

Don't run the Diamonds off that. They are too power hungry for 75W per channel. It's probably doable with the Focals though.

I've never used Xtant myself. I know one of the local high end shows premiers them, so they can't be that bad. I remember they didn't use to have a fully regulated power supply, but it seems that they do now. If the price/size/features are right you probably have nothing to worry about.

First, you probably didn't find anything because it's spelled Xtant, not Extant. Not ragging on ya, just sayin....

I've had a couple Xtant amps before, and they kick ass! I ran a set of Alpine Type-X components off of a 403X and it was amazing, then I ran a pair of Xtant 12s off of an old X1001 and it was just as amazing. They are perfectly clear amps, very highly regarded in the SQ (Sound Quality) circles, but they have enough punch to stay with more bass-oriented music.

Honestly the older Xtant amps are way better, the guy that used to make them (by hand) is the one who designed the new JL amps (not my fav, but not his fault, design is awesome). In a newer Xtant you're losing some of that show-winning quality, but they're still in the top 5 amps for SQ.
